Background technique
Aluminum alloy doors and windows refer to and aluminum alloy extrusion section bar are used to be known as aluminium alloy door for the door and window of frame, stile, fan material production Window, abbreviation aluminium door and window.Aluminum alloy doors and windows include making stressed member (rod piece for bearing and transmitting self weight and load) base with aluminium alloy Door and window material and that timber, plastics are compound, abbreviation aluminum wood composite door and window, aluminous plastic compound door & window.Aluminum alloy doors and windows quality can be from The selections of raw material (aluminum profile), aluminium material surface processing and internal processing quality, the price of aluminum alloy doors and windows etc. are big to make Cause judgement.Aluminum alloy doors and windows have sliding aluminium alloy door, aluminum alloy sliding window, are opened flat aluminium alloy door, are opened flat aluminum window and aluminium conjunction Five kinds of golden floor spring door.There is national building standard design drawing.Each door and window is divided into basic door and window and combined door and window.Elementary gate Window is made of frame, fan, glass, Hardware fitting, sealing material etc..Combined door and window by more than two basic door and window jointing materials or Turn to window or door with side window that material is combined into other forms.Every kind of door and window is divided into several series, example by sash thickness construction size Such as the sliding aluminium alloy door that doorframe thickness construction size is 90mm, then referred to as 90 serial sliding aluminium alloy door.
In addition, the aluminum alloy doors and windows with heat and sound isolation effect are a kind of door and windows with market prospects, it is existing Aluminum alloy doors and windows Shortcomings equal in the following areas: one, thermal insulation and sound insulation effect is poor, poor sealing;Two, existing heat insulation Sound aluminum alloy doors and windows, since fixed frame upper and lower ends are internally provided with sliding slot, install the other end after one end when installation Very bad installation needs to adjust the angle always in the presence of the risk for smashing glass, and working efficiency is low, at high cost.

Embodiment 2
The present embodiment is the improvement to telescopic fixing rod 12 in embodiment 1 and 11 connection type of external extension fixing seat, in reality Apply in example 1, telescopic fixing rod 12 is fixedly connected by welding manner with external extension fixing seat 11, welding manner there is also it is some not Foot, for example the operation of small space is more complicated, finished surface unsightly, moreover, when the material of connection has differences, such as External extension fixing seat 11 is aluminium alloy, and when telescopic fixing rod 12 is steel material, steel aluminium weld interface, which is easy to produce defect, to be caused Weld strength is insufficient.
In the present embodiment, as illustrated in figs. 5-7, not phase relatively is circumferentially provided in the tail end of the telescopic fixing rod 12 The two sections of arc grooves 125 connect are equipped in the position that the external extension fixing seat 11 is connect with the tail end of the telescopic fixing rod 12 Mounting groove 111 is connected with plate 113 by spring 112 respectively on the 111 left and right ends inner wall of mounting groove, described in two sides Plate 113 is oppositely arranged, and upper part is provided with arc notch, the arc notch shape and 12 tail end of telescopic fixing rod Two sections of arc grooves 125 are adapted, in this way, it is achieved that the quick grafting of telescopic fixing rod 12 Yu external extension fixing seat 11, moreover, This connection is removably, to further improve the agility and convenience of installation, also avoid welding defect, improve peace The stability of dress.
Further, as shown in Figure 6,7, the arc notch upper edge on the plate 113 is equipped with the gradient of back taper, into one Step facilitates the quick insertion of the tail end of telescopic fixing rod 12.
